当前位置:首页 > 科技动态 > 正文

数据库中的索引都有什么作用是什么

数据库中的索引都有什么作用是什么

内容:数据库索引是数据库管理系统中的一种数据结构,它可以帮助快速定位和检索数据。以下是数据库索引的几个关键作用:1. 提高查询效率数据库索引能够显著提升查询速度。当数据...

内容:

数据库索引是数据库管理系统中的一种数据结构,它可以帮助快速定位和检索数据。以下是数据库索引的几个关键作用:

1. 提高查询效率

数据库索引能够显著提升查询速度。当数据库执行查询操作时,如果没有索引,数据库需要扫描整个表来查找所需的数据,这会非常耗时。而有了索引,数据库可以快速定位到数据所在的位置,从而大大减少查询所需的时间。

2. 加速排序操作

在执行排序操作时,索引可以极大地提高效率。如果表中的数据已经按照索引列排序,那么排序操作将变得非常快速。这是因为索引本身就是一种排序后的数据结构,可以直接利用。

3. 支持数据唯一性

索引可以确保数据的唯一性。例如,在用户表中,通常会对用户名或电子邮件地址设置唯一索引,这样就可以保证每个用户名或电子邮件地址在表中是唯一的。

4. 优化表连接操作

在执行表连接操作时,索引能够帮助数据库更快地找到匹配的行。这对于复杂的查询和大数据量的表连接尤其重要。

5. 提供数据检索的灵活性

索引提供了多种检索数据的途径,不仅限于简单的等于(=)操作,还包括范围查询、模糊查询等,使得数据检索更加灵活。

通过以上作用,数据库索引在保证数据检索速度和查询效率方面扮演着至关重要的角色。

最新文章